Robert Greene 1921–2009 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1 Mar 1921

Birth Location: Norton, Wise, Virginia, USA

Death Date: 17 Mar 2009

Death Location: Big Stone Gap, Wise, Virginia, USA

Father: Charles Green

Mother: Roberta Beverly

Spouse(s): Edna Hall, Grace Reynolds

Children(s):

The story of Robert Greene began in 1921 in Norton, Wise, Virginia, USA. In 1942, Robert Greene resided in Norton, Wise, Virginia, USA. In 1950, Robert Greene resided in Estillville, Scott, Virginia, USA. Robert Greene married Edna Lois Hall, Grace Gordon Reynolds, and had children including Robert G Green. Robert Greene passed away in 2009 in Big Stone Gap, Wise, Virginia, USA.
